Altay tourist industry and regional authorities apply an effort to regain the tourists. To remind that in June, local entrepreneurs and operators suffered serious losses related to the consequences of the unprecedented floods. The main task for them now is to restore the reputation of the sector as soon as possible, persuading agents and tourists that it is still safe to go for vacation to Altai.
Last weekend, the tourist center of the Altai Krai organized a press tour in the Altaysky District. The journalists from Siberian Regions had a chance to get convinced that everything works normally, sightseeing tours are available, tourists are welcomed as never before. "The losses for those days, when tourists did not visit us will never be compensated, feels sorry Natalia Gordeeva, the president of the Altai Regional Tourism Association (ARTA) and the director of the Barnaul-based "Altayturist" company. – But returning to the last year's workload in July and August is feasible, I think. In our region, prior to the season have opened new hotels, many already operating facilities have increased the number of rooms." The prices in most tourist centers have not changed for the last 3-4 years, despite inflation and increased expenses. Approximately one third of all facilities, according to the regional tourist industry representatives, reduced prices by 5-10% and in some cases even up to 50%.
